Mise en scene
This term defines the arrangement of the scene. What the movie or show is trying to convey by
the arrangement of the props. Like if the whole movie is romantic then they shall be using mild
beautiful objects like flower, books, library or cake in the scene. Where after every shot the hero
will be trying to impress the actress. The setting of the surrounding of the set of the film defines
the term Mise en scene.
The movie under analysis is “ knives out” it was released in November 2019. It’s a mysterious
thriller story about the death of a famous novelist Harlan Thrombey. The irony of the movie is
that the novelist who is the center of the movie was very much fascinated by the knives and he
had master piece constructed of the knives in the middle of the home. He was a very bossy
person and in his extended family he used to make rules for everyone. The detective played by
Benoit Blanc ties to unravel the case of the murder mystery of the novelist and makes everyone
the suspects in his house. The knife is the prop that indicates the family bitterness for each other
and the murder object. The knives also depict the novelist point of view regarding his own
sharpness and his anger for his family.

The Kuleshov effect
The Kuleshov effect is very commonly used in film editing effect. It is a psychological
phenomenon by which viewers tries to find more meaning from the interaction of two sequential
shots instead of single shot in isolation. Daniel Craig who is playing Benoit Blanc the famous
private detective is show in the beginning of the scene interrogating the suspects and showing
how he is observing their answers, body language and pause that they take while replying. In
whole of movie the scene where the detective is trying to figure out the point of murder and how
he keep his facial expression same throughout the interrogation is building the seriousness in the
movie. At all points when interacts each of the family member he uses his intense look to create
a suspense in the atmosphere where at any point the person accepts his crime. By looking at each
of the scene where we find Daniel Craig we think that the killer is the person he is interrogating.
In each of the scene we see him intensifying his role. And there the audience is convinced that
the person is the murderer even when he is not.
